KEIZER, Ore.–  The McNary Football team opened their four-day Kid’s Camp with 150 kids, aging between Kindergarten and eighth graders in attendance. 
Split up in age groups, they ran through drills and an obstacle course to close out the first day on Monday evening at McNary High School.  Each drill was run by some of the Celtic Coaching Staff and some of the McNary High School Football players.
The number of kids out for the first day impressed Head Coach Josh Riddell, who’s excited to see what is to come over the next three days of the camp.
“I was excited, just making sure we give the community something to look forward to and just have fun.  I think we did that the first day and can’t wait to see the next three days,” Riddell said.
The camp runs through Thursday, from 5pm until 6:30pm.  The cost is 20 dollars and will be on the turf at McNary High School.
